Output 621000cc3f5eeadb872b8d7790e3a198cec7b786e508f54704dcc7c42d53eef9:1

value
8979514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 228bdacad741ab0153faa953cf606beab536afb1 OP_EQUAL
address
MB3pkDy6SN8BfVtGAiWWFiA2i8yy1hHQH4
transaction
621000cc3f5eeadb872b8d7790e3a198cec7b786e508f54704dcc7c42d53eef9
spent
true